3 of 5 stars Reviewed 16 February 2012

on a hill overlooking this university town, the monument is principally a series of lecture theatres, stages and meeting rooms. it's surrounded by a garden and offers views to the distant hills. the idea was that of prof guy butler, legendary professor of english who massively expanded his section of the university's offering and founded the literary festival that fills...
